Usage notes
Common mistakes
耗 meaning 'to waste' often collocates with time or resources (e.g., 耗时间, 耗电), not with concrete objects like food or money.
Formality
耗 is informal when meaning 'to delay' or 'to dilly-dally', often used in colloquial speech.
